Job Description

Your new role

We have an opportunity for an experienced Handyperson to join the team reporting to the Chief Engineer. This varied role requires you to maintain the building plant & equipment fixtures and fittings throughout the hotel to the required standard. You will ensure a pleasant and safe environment for all guests visitors and employees.

Your daily mission may include but not limited to the following:

  • Inspect all areas of the property for safety issues and take immediate corrective action.
  • Assist guests regarding property facilities in an informative and helpful way.
  • Undertaking general repairs and maintenance as well as preventative maintenance programs throughout the Hotel. This includes basic plumbing air conditioning service and repairs.
  • Pool maintenance including use of chemicals and water treatment.
  • Servicing of plant and general equipment as directed.
  • Ensuring all painted areas are maintained and in good order.
  • Performing duties relevant to experience and trade as applicable and perform other maintenance related tasks as required.
  • Report any health or safety hazards or incidents faults repairs cleaning needs and accidents to your manager and record on the appropriate form immediately following accident. Participate in any required actions following the incident. 

Qualifications :

Your experience and skills include:

  • Relevant building maintenance experience is an asset.
  • Previous experience in a similar role or the ability to demonstrate skills required to be successful in this role.
  • Strong interpersonal and problem solving abilities.
  • Highly responsible & reliable.
  • The ability to work both unsupervised and in a team environment.
  • Attention to detail.
  • Excellent customer service skills.
  • Training in pool quality training preferred.
  • Relevant trade qualification is an asset.
